## Description

The Government has a requirement to develop automated test equipment (ATE) and calibration instrumentation (standards) in the biological agent defense parameter to the fullest extent possible. The Government requires the development, test, evaluation, and training of engineering prototypes to support emerging gaps in calibration capability with high stability and accuracy.

The Government has a requirement to develop biological detection calibration capability to work with the modernized calibration sets and meet current and future biological detection calibration and repair requirements. The Biosensor Calibrator is a calibration standard for fielded and future DoD biological warfare agent sensors that use laser induced fluorescence (LIF) technology.

The Joint Biological Point Detection System (JBPDS) and the Joint Biological Tactical Detection System (JBTDS) are examples of currently fielded items that this calibration standard will support. The Government has an urgent need to develop an engineering prototype of a Biosensor Calibrator capable of producing positive identification of aerosolized, surface, and human surrogate pathogen contamination samples.

The prototype must be capable of passing all performance parameters with accuracy traceable to the National Institute of Standards and Technology (NIST) and to transfer those accuracies to the Joint Force field biodetectors. The Contractor shall design, acquire, implement, test, deliver, and support the integration of robust sensing chips and a high-throughput (HT) and multiplex Biosensor Calibrator and the associated documentation as specified.
